Summary: This course shows users how to use various techniques to create sophisticated reports with FOCUS.
Ojectives: After completing this course, students will be able to: Use the rules for coding statements in FOCUS graph requests
Describe how to use advanced sorting techniques when creating reports
Create headings and footings, including positioning text
Rank and summarize numeric data
Create totals in your reports and print them
Topics: Course Conventions and Databases
Advanced Sorting Techniques
Creating Matrix Reports
Additional Formatting Options
Ranking Data
Subtotaling Operations
The WHEN Clause
